| using DescentPath = std::vector<SymbolTag>; |
| |
| // Returns a vector of all descendants of symbol that are precisely along |
| // path. |
| // Path starts at symbol's children. Reported descendants match last element |
| // in path. |
| // |
| // Note that this does a recursive branching descent. Every descendant that |
| // that is found along path is added. This can potentially traverse symbol's |
| // entire subtree and return a very large vector if symbol's subtree contains |
| // path in many different ways. |
| // |
| std::vector<const Symbol*> GetAllDescendantsFromPath(const Symbol& symbol, |
| const DescentPath& path); |
